Cheapest Available Blythewood and Nearby 1 Bedroom Apartments

As of June 27, 2025 the lowest priced 1 Bedroom apartment unit in Blythewood, SC is the One Bed Model starting from $828 at Garden Lakes in the Lincolnshire neighborhood. The second most affordable Blythewood 1 Bedroom is the Daylilly Model at Greenbrier starting at $869 in the Dentsville neighborhood. The average price for all 1 Bedroom apartments in Blythewood is currently $1,397.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 1 Bedroom options in Blythewood:

Getting Around Blythewood, SC

Walk Score®

16 / 100

Car-Dependent

Almost all errands require a car

Bike Score®

24 / 100

Somewhat Bikeable

Minimal bike infrastructure
